Ehiozuwa Agbonayinwa, NDC senatorial aspirant, accuses party national leader Seriake Dickson of overriding primary election results. Agbonayinwa claims he won the May 29 NDC senatorial primary but Dickson plans to give the ticket to another candidate.

The aggrieved aspirant made the allegation during an interview on Channels Television's 'Politics Today' on Friday. He highlighted that NDC conducted primaries on May 29 but has not announced results six days later. 'Dickson disappointed me totally,' Agbonayinwa stated. 'He told me to get the NDC Senate ticket, and I won the primary. The same Dickson is now saying the party will do affirmation for one Ijaw lady instead of going with the primary election result.'

The aspirant referenced Aisha Yesufu's protest at the NDC national secretariat, suggesting internal party tensions. With reports of massively rigged NDC primaries in other regions, this dispute highlights internal power struggles within the party that could affect voter confidence.
